// REPLICA_LAG_ALARM_THRESHOLD_MS
// Alarm for read-replica lag on the Quillbase cluster serving Norvane's
// billing reads. Security note: the alarm handler runs with read-only
// credentials scoped to the metrics schema; it cannot touch customer rows.
// Threshold raised from 500ms to 1500ms after the Brindlehurst failover
// drill produced false pages. Do not lower without sign-off from the data
// platform rotation. The build that last changed this constant is
// recorded below.

session token of yajof-bagef = htk4_937d

## Seat-map renderer rework (Velvet Curtain v2)

This PR swaps the old canvas renderer for a tiled SVG approach in the Orpheum Hall seat picker. Security-relevant bits: seat metadata is now sanitized server-side before templating, and the zoom/pan handlers clamp input to avoid the DoS-y redraw loops we saw in fuzzing. No new deps. Render throttling and cache limits are centralized in one module now, so they're easy to audit. The tuning constants are:

tuning table, kajog-bawip:
TIERS = {
    "kelius": 256,
    "lammir": 543,
}

**Test Plan Note — Freightwise Rules Engine**

Shipping-fee rules are evaluated server-side; client-submitted fee overrides must be rejected. Test cases cover tier boundaries, negative weights, and rule-priority conflicts. Security review should focus on the rule-upload endpoint, which accepts serialized definitions. Staging runs require authenticated calls; use the token below.

session JWT of yawep-yawep = eyJhbGciOiJIUzI1NiIsInR5cCI6IkpXVCJ9.eyJzdWIiOiI3pWF3_In0.aXYsHiog

Subject: Tracing setup for the Quillbrook integration

Hi, and welcome aboard. As you wire your services into the Quillbrook mesh, please propagate our trace header on every outbound call, including retries — dropped headers are the main reason spans appear orphaned in the Lanternview dashboard. Sampling is set to 20% in staging, so don't panic if some requests vanish. To query the trace API directly while you're validating your integration, authenticate with the token below.

login token, yagaf-hawip: eyJhbGciOiJIUzI1NiIsInR5cCI6IkpXVCJ9.eyJzdWIiOiIdHjlcNIn0.AFyH-u9q